Gravity and physical property data, basin depth of the Hayfork graben, and horizontal gradient maxima of the southern Klamath Mountains, California
This data release contains principal facts of gravity measurements collected by the U.S. Geological Survey in 2013-2022, a compilation of existing and new density and magnetic susceptibility data, horizontal gradient maxima derived from gravity and magnetic potential fields, and depth of Cenozoic basin fill in the Hayfork basin from inversion of gravity data of the southern Klamath Mountains, California. These data support modeling of gravity and magnetic anomalies to understand the structure beneath the southern Klamath Mountains.
